Product Description

Light steel structure pigsties and chicken houses are currently the mainstream choice for modern livestock buildings. Engineered with galvanized light gauge steel framing, these structures offer rapid on‑site assembly, exceptional structural integrity, and proven resistance to high‑wind events including typhoons. The system is suitable for swine and poultry operations of all scales, from farrowing barns to finishing houses and from broiler sheds to layer facilities. Prefabricated components are manufactured with precision, enabling quick erection while maintaining dimensional accuracy for seamless integration with automated feeding, ventilation, and manure handling equipment. The light steel framework provides a durable, low‑maintenance envelope that protects animals from extreme weather.

Technical Specifications



Parameter Specification
Frame Material Hot‑dip galvanized light gauge steel (Z275‑Z350 coating)
Column & Rafter C or U shaped cold‑formed sections, thickness 1.5‑3.0mm
Roof Cladding Corrugated steel sheet or sandwich panel (EPS/PU)
Wall Cladding Corrugated steel or insulated panel with vents
Span Width 6‑24 meters (customizable)
Bay Spacing 3‑6 meters
Wind Load Resistance Up to 12‑level typhoon (≥ 32.7m/s basic wind speed)
Snow Load 0.3‑0.8 kN/m² (depending on regional code)
Assembly Method Pre‑drilled bolted connection, no welding required
Foundation Type Concrete strip or column footing (low volume)
Lead Time from Order Short (prefabrication + fast site assembly)

Classified Applications & Advantages

1. Fast Construction Speed

  • Pre‑engineered components – All frame members, connectors, and cladding are factory cut and drilled; no on‑site cutting or welding

  • Bolted assembly only – A small crew can erect a 1000m² house in days, not weeks, using basic tools

  • Parallel site work – Foundation preparation and frame fabrication occur simultaneously, shortening overall project timeline

  • Immediate occupancy – Animals can be moved in as soon as cladding and insulation are complete – no curing time required

2. Typhoon & High Wind Resistance

  • Continuous load path – Galvanized steel sections from roof to foundation are bolted together, transferring wind forces directly to the ground

  • Diaphragm action – Roof and wall cladding act as shear panels, stiffening the entire structure against lateral pressure

  • Proven in cyclone zones – Engineering standards meet or exceed building codes for typhoon‑prone regions (e.g., Southeast Asia, Coastal China, Caribbean)

  • Anti‑lift connections – Specified hold‑down anchors prevent roof uplift during extreme gusts

3. Structural & Material Advantages

  • High strength‑to‑weight ratio – Light gauge steel carries heavy live loads (equipment, snow, workers) while weighing 50‑60% less than timber or concrete frames

  • Galvanized corrosion protection – Z275‑Z350 coating resists ammonia, manure gases, and humidity for 20+ years without red rust

  • Non‑combustible – Steel framing does not contribute to fire spread, improving barn fire safety ratings

  • Termite & rot proof – No wood to decay or attract pests; ideal for tropical and humid climates

4. Design Flexibility for Livestock Needs

  • Clear span interiors – No internal columns within the usable width, allowing unobstructed cage rows, feeding equipment, and skid‑steer loaders

  • Customizable eave height – Adjustable from 2.5m to 5m+ to accommodate stacked cages, ventilation inlets, or automatic manure scrapers

  • Easy expansion – Modular design permits adding bays at either end without demolishing existing sections

  • Integration ready – Pre‑drilled attachment points for ventilation fans, feed bins, water lines, and light fixtures

5. Application Scenarios

  • Pig finishing houses – Wide clear spans (up to 24m) allow multiple rows of pens with central service alley; high wind resistance protects lightweight roof insulation

  • Farrowing barns – Lower eave height (2.5‑3m) reduces air volume for efficient heating; fast construction enables quick replacement of storm‑damaged buildings

  • Broiler chicken sheds – Long span + side wall roll‑up curtains; light steel frame supports suspended automatic feeding lines and exhaust fans

  • Layer houses – Multi‑tier cage systems require flat, level floors and strong roof purlins for hanging egg belts – light steel provides both

  • Quarantine & isolation units – Small single‑bay structures can be erected rapidly during disease outbreaks to separate affected groups

  • Greenfield farms in typhoon zones – Whole farm layout of multiple houses can be prefabricated simultaneously and erected in sequence

6. Operational Advantages Compared to Traditional Construction

  • Diminishes site disruption – Prefabricated components arrive ready to install; no concrete mixing piles, lumber storage, or brick laying mess

  • Reduces foundation requirements – Lighter frame needs less concrete than heavy steel or masonry, simplifying site preparation

  • Allows relocation – Bolted connections can be disassembled and moved to a new site if needed (unlike welded or cast‑in‑place structures)

  • Compatible with all cladding types – Accepts insulated panels, single skin sheets, polycarbonate sheets, or mesh curtains for open‑sided designs

7. Environmental & Maintenance Advantages

  • 100% recyclable – Steel frame can be melted down and reused at end of life; no demolition waste to landfill

  • Low maintenance exterior – Galvanized surface requires no painting; occasional wash down restores appearance

  • Reflective roof option – White or light‑colored cladding reduces solar heat gain, lowering cooling load in hot climates
